Modifying Estimates

The estimate tree can be found on the estimates window.

Estimates can be grouped into trees and sub-trees.

To modify an estimate, select it in the tree and the details tab will be populated with the current parameters for that estimate. New parameters can be entered into the details tab form and the changes are automatically applied.

Estimate Type

The type of an estimate is important as it affects the way the estimated and actual values impact the ending balances.

  • Income - Income estimates represent an expected increase to net worth, such as a paycheck.
  • Expense - Expense estimates represent an expected decrease to net worth, such as a utility bill.
  • Transfer - Transfer estimates represent an expected transfer of funds from one account to another, such as a credit card payment. Transfer estimates have no impact to ending balances (see transfer estimate best practices)
  • Category - Category estimates group child estimates together. Category estimates have no estimated amount, and therefore no impact to ending balances.

Due Date

If an estimate represents an expense with a particular due date (such as a utility bill), the due date can be specified. Until a transaction is assigned to an estimate with a due date, the due date is shown in the estimate progress window.

Complete Estimates

If all activity against an estimate has occurred and the actual is less than the estimated (i.e., under-budget), the unspent funds can be reclaimed by marking the estimate as complete. When calculating the expected ending balance, the actual value is used for complete estimates rather than the estimated value.

Creating Estimates

To create a new top-level estimate, right-click anywhere in the estimate tree window and select Create top-level estimate.

To create a new estimate as a child of an existing estimate, select the parent estimate and click the Add Child button in the details tab.

Deleting Estimates

To delete an estimate, select the desired estimate and click the Delete button in the details tab.

At this time, deletion of category estimates with children is not allowed. All child estimates must be deleted first.
